Dysart is a locality in Tama County, Iowa, United States. It has a population of approximately 1,519. The population density is 486.2 people per km². Dysart is located at 42.1717°N, 92.3063°W. It observes the Central Time (America/Chicago) timezone. ZIP code: 52224.

It lies 22.3 miles south of Waterloo, IA (from Waterloo, IA: bearing 175°T), and is situated 8.3 miles east of Traer.
